Maldives Airports Company Limited (MACL) has announced temporary parking restrictions in preparation for the official opening event of Velana International Airport’s New Passenger Terminal, scheduled for 26th July 2025.

According to MACL, parking in designated areas will be suspended as follows:
East Side Parking Zone:
Parking of four-wheeled vehicles will not be allowed from 17th July 2025 onwards. Vehicle owners are requested to clear any parked vehicles from the east side zone by that date.
West Side Parking Zone:
Parking restrictions for all vehicles will come into effect from 18:00 on 17th July 2025.
MACL has also cautioned that any vehicles left in these areas after the stated times will be towed with assistance from Maldives Police Service.
The company noted that the reopening date for both parking zones will be communicated at a later time.
MACL expressed its apologies for any inconvenience caused and called for the public’s cooperation to ensure smooth preparations for the new terminal’s opening.
